Biden: The US will not allow Iran to acquire nuclear weapons

THE Joe Biden had a telephone conversation with Israeli Prime Minister Yair Lapid, where, among other things, according to a Washington official, the American president emphasized that the Iran should not acquire nuclear weapons.

According to Reuters, the two leaders “discussed at length negotiations for an agreement on Iran’s nuclear program,” their “commitment to stop Iran’s progress toward a nuclear weapon” and Iran’s regional influence. , according to the statement issued by Lapid’s office.

“In this context, the prime minister underlined the importance of the strikes ordered by President Biden in Syria,” the Israeli statement added, noting that Lapid and Biden agree on Israel’s right to “self-defense.”

In fact, in Washington, a White House official said that President Biden told Yair Lapid during their telephone conversation that the US would not allow Iran to acquire a nuclear weapon, amid discussions about a possible agreement on the Iranian nuclear program, as Tehran is demanding stronger guarantees from Washington to revive the 2015 deal, which Israel strongly opposes.

“The president underscored the U.S. commitment to never allow Iran to obtain a nuclear weapon” in the phone call in which Biden and Lapid also discussed “threats posed by Iran,” the White House said.
